diff --git a/weed/server/volume_grpc_client.go b/weed/server/volume_grpc_client.go index ecafd5658..29c608666 100644 --- a/weed/server/volume_grpc_client.go +++ b/weed/server/volume_grpc_client.go @@ -82,7 +82,7 @@ func (vs *VolumeServer) doHeartbeat(sleepInterval time.Duration) error { return err } - tickChan := time.NewTimer(sleepInterval).C + tickChan := time.Tick(sleepInterval) for { select { @@ -92,6 +92,7 @@ func (vs *VolumeServer) doHeartbeat(sleepInterval time.Duration) error { return err } case err := <-doneChan: + glog.V(0).Infof("Volume Server heart beat stops with %v", err) return err } }